市值: $2.6514T -5.90%
成交额(24h): $192.6442B 48.21%
恐惧与贪婪指数:

18 - 极度恐惧

  • 市值: $2.6514T -5.90%
  • 成交额(24h): $192.6442B 48.21%
  • 恐惧与贪婪指数:
  • 市值: $2.6514T -5.90%
加密货币
话题
百科
资讯
加密话题
视频
热门加密百科

选择语种

选择语种

选择货币

加密货币
话题
百科
资讯
加密话题
视频

加密货币钱包的公钥与私钥之间有什么关系?

Public and private keys are essential for secure crypto transactions; the private key signs transactions, while the public key verifies them on the blockchain.

2025/04/15 02:07

加密货币钱包的公钥与私钥之间的关系是了解加密货币如何安全起作用的基础。这两个钥匙构成了加密系统的基础,可确保区块链交易的安全性和完整性。在本文中,我们将详细探讨这些密钥是什么,它们的生成方式以及它们如何交互以确保您的加密货币持有量。

什么是公钥?

公共密钥是一个来自您的私钥的加密代码,用于接收加密货币。它是非对称加密系统的一部分,这意味着它可以公开共享而不会损害您的资金安全性。

公共密钥通常以更具用户友好的格式表示,称为加密货币地址。当您想获得资金时,此地址是您与他人分享的地址。例如,在Bitcoin中,将公共密钥进行哈希键并编码为Bitcoin地址,该地址通常以“ 1”或“ 3”或“ BC1”开头,具体取决于地址格式。

什么是私钥?

另一方面,私钥是一个秘密号码,用于签署交易并证明对应的公钥及其相关的资金的所有权。必须将私钥保持秘密,因为任何访问它的人都可以控制链接到相应公共密钥的资金。

私钥通常是一串长字母数字字符。例如,Bitcoin私钥可能看起来像这样: 5Kb8kLf9zgWQnogidDA76MzPL6TsZZY36hWXMssSzNydYXYB9KV

如何产生公共密钥和私钥?

公共和私钥的产生涉及复杂的数学算法。该过程始于创建私钥,该钥匙通常是使用加密功能随机生成的。

  • 生成一个私钥:这是使用安全的随机数生成器完成的。私钥必须足够长且无法预测,以确保安全。
  • 得出公共密钥:公共密钥是使用椭圆曲线乘法从私钥得出的。在Bitcoin中,这涉及SECP256K1椭圆曲线。公共密钥是该曲线上的一个点,计算为私钥乘以曲线的发电机点。

公共密钥与私钥之间的关系是使公共密钥可以源自私钥,但反之亦然。这种单向功能是确保系统安全性的原因。

公共和私钥如何相互作用?

当您想发送加密货币时,您可以使用私钥签署交易。该签名证明该交易是由私钥的所有者授权的。交易以及签名将广播到网络,节点使用相应的公钥验证签名。

  • 创建交易:您指定收件人的地址和要发送的金额。
  • 签署交易:使用私钥,您创建一个附加到交易的数字签名。
  • 广播交易:交易以及签名将发送到网络。
  • 验证:网络上的节点使用公共密钥来验证签名。如果匹配,则认为交易有效,可以包含在块中。

此过程确保只有私钥的所有者才能花费资金,而任何人都可以使用公共密钥验证交易。

公共和私钥的安全含义

加密货币钱包的安全性取决于私钥的安全保管。如果其他人可以访问您的私钥,他们可以控制您的资金。因此,通常使用诸如硬件钱包或纸钱包之类的方法安全地存储私钥至关重要。

公共密钥是源自私钥的,不需要保密。但是,仔细处理仍然很重要。例如,如果您过于广泛地共享您的公钥,则可能会使用它来链接您的交易,从而损害您的隐私。

实际示例:在Bitcoin中使用公共和私钥

让我们浏览一个实用的例子,说明公共钥匙和私钥如何在Bitcoin中工作:

  • 生成一个Bitcoin地址:首先使用Bitcoin钱包软件生成私钥。从这个私钥中,钱包将得出一个公钥,然后将其转换为Bitcoin地址。
  • 接收Bitcoin :与想要发送给您的人共享Bitcoin地址(源自公共密钥)Bitcoin。他们将Bitcoin发送到此地址。
  • 发送Bitcoin :要发送Bitcoin,您需要创建一个事务。您将指定收件人的Bitcoin地址和要发送的金额。然后,您的钱包将使用您的私钥签署此交易。
  • 事务验证:签名的交易被广播到Bitcoin网络。网络上的节点使用公共密钥(从您的Bitcoin地址派生)来验证签名。如果有效,则交易包含在一个块中并添加到区块链中。

此示例说明了公共密钥和私钥之间的无缝互动,以确保区块链上的安全和可验证的交易。

常见问题

Q1:可以使用公共密钥查找私钥吗?

不,由于使用的加密算法的单向性质,从公共密钥中得出私钥是计算上不可行的。这就是确保系统安全性的原因。

问题2:与他人分享我的公钥是否安全?

是的,可以安全地与他人共享您的公钥或相应的加密货币地址。公共密钥旨在共享,不会损害您的私钥或资金的安全性。

Q3:如果我的私钥丢失或被盗会发生什么?

如果您的私钥丢失,您将无法访问或控制与之相关的资金。如果被盗,小偷可以控制这些资金。因此,至关重要的是要确保您的私钥安全并安全存储备份。

Q4:可以将同一私钥用于多个加密货币吗?

通常,没有。不同的加密货币使用不同的加密算法和地址格式。尽管某些多货币钱包可能会使用单个私钥来得出多个地址,但每个加密货币通常都需要其自己的私钥以进行完整的兼容性和安全性。

免责声明:info@kdj.com

所提供的信息并非交易建议。根据本文提供的信息进行的任何投资,kdj.com不承担任何责任。加密货币具有高波动性,强烈建议您深入研究后,谨慎投资!

如您认为本网站上使用的内容侵犯了您的版权,请立即联系我们(info@kdj.com),我们将及时删除。

相关百科

什么是减半? (了解Bitcoin的供应计划)

什么是减半? (了解Bitcoin的供应计划)

2026-01-16 00:19:50

什么是 Bitcoin 减半? 1. Bitcoin 减半是嵌入在 Bitcoin 协议中的预编程事件,它将给予矿工的区块奖励减少 50%。 2. 大约每 210,000 个区块发生一次,根据 Bitcoin 的平均出块时间 10 分钟,大约每四年发生一次。 3. 该机制由中本聪设计,旨在加强稀缺性...

什么是玩赚钱 (P2E) 游戏及其运作方式?

什么是玩赚钱 (P2E) 游戏及其运作方式?

2026-01-12 20:19:33

定义和核心机制1. Play-to-Earn (P2E) 游戏是基于区块链的数字体验,玩家通过游戏活动赚取加密货币代币或不可替代代币 (NFT)。 2. 这些游戏依靠去中心化账本技术来验证所有权、转移资产并在全球参与者网络中透明地分配奖励。 3. 与传统视频游戏不同,P2E 游戏将经济系统直接嵌入其...

什么是内存池以及交易如何得到确认?

什么是内存池以及交易如何得到确认?

2026-01-24 06:00:16

什么是内存池? 1.内存池是每个Bitcoin节点内的临时存储区域,用于保存未确认的交易。 2. 交易在广播到网络后但在矿工将其纳入区块之前进入内存池。 3. 每个完整节点都维护自己的内存池版本,由于延迟或策略变化,该版本可能略有不同。 4. 内存池的大小和组成会根据网络拥塞、交易费用和区块空间可用...

如何用加密货币赚取被动收入?

如何用加密货币赚取被动收入?

2026-01-13 07:39:45

质押机制1. 质押是指在钱包中锁定一定数量的加密货币,以支持交易验证和共识维护等网络操作。 2. 参与者收到以他们所持有的相同代币计价的奖励,通常根据网络定义的参数定期分配。 3. 以太坊向权益证明的过渡显着增加了散户通过 Lido 和 Rocket Pool 等平台的可及性。 4. 一些协议规定了...

什么是零知识证明(ZK-Proofs)?

什么是零知识证明(ZK-Proofs)?

2026-01-22 04:40:14

定义和核心概念1. 零知识证明(ZK-Proofs)是一种加密协议,使一方能够向另一方证明陈述的真实性,而不会泄露超出该陈述有效性的任何潜在信息。 2. ZK-proof 必须满足三个基本属性:完整性、健全性和零知识——这意味着诚实的证明者可以说服诚实的验证者,不诚实的证明者不能误导验证者,除非概率...

什么是区块链三难困境? (安全性、可扩展性和去中心化)

什么是区块链三难困境? (安全性、可扩展性和去中心化)

2026-01-15 17:00:25

了解核心冲突1. 区块链三难困境描述了一个基本的架构约束,即在单个区块链协议中同时最大化安全性、可扩展性和去中心化是极其困难的。 2. 每个重大设计决策都需要权衡——增加吞吐量通常需要减少节点数量或简化共识逻辑,这会削弱去中心化或引入新的攻击向量。 3. Bitcoin优先考虑安全性和去中心化,但将...

什么是减半? (了解Bitcoin的供应计划)

什么是减半? (了解Bitcoin的供应计划)

2026-01-16 00:19:50

什么是 Bitcoin 减半? 1. Bitcoin 减半是嵌入在 Bitcoin 协议中的预编程事件,它将给予矿工的区块奖励减少 50%。 2. 大约每 210,000 个区块发生一次,根据 Bitcoin 的平均出块时间 10 分钟,大约每四年发生一次。 3. 该机制由中本聪设计,旨在加强稀缺性...

什么是玩赚钱 (P2E) 游戏及其运作方式?

什么是玩赚钱 (P2E) 游戏及其运作方式?

2026-01-12 20:19:33

定义和核心机制1. Play-to-Earn (P2E) 游戏是基于区块链的数字体验,玩家通过游戏活动赚取加密货币代币或不可替代代币 (NFT)。 2. 这些游戏依靠去中心化账本技术来验证所有权、转移资产并在全球参与者网络中透明地分配奖励。 3. 与传统视频游戏不同,P2E 游戏将经济系统直接嵌入其...

什么是内存池以及交易如何得到确认?

什么是内存池以及交易如何得到确认?

2026-01-24 06:00:16

什么是内存池? 1.内存池是每个Bitcoin节点内的临时存储区域,用于保存未确认的交易。 2. 交易在广播到网络后但在矿工将其纳入区块之前进入内存池。 3. 每个完整节点都维护自己的内存池版本,由于延迟或策略变化,该版本可能略有不同。 4. 内存池的大小和组成会根据网络拥塞、交易费用和区块空间可用...

如何用加密货币赚取被动收入?

如何用加密货币赚取被动收入?

2026-01-13 07:39:45

质押机制1. 质押是指在钱包中锁定一定数量的加密货币,以支持交易验证和共识维护等网络操作。 2. 参与者收到以他们所持有的相同代币计价的奖励,通常根据网络定义的参数定期分配。 3. 以太坊向权益证明的过渡显着增加了散户通过 Lido 和 Rocket Pool 等平台的可及性。 4. 一些协议规定了...

什么是零知识证明(ZK-Proofs)?

什么是零知识证明(ZK-Proofs)?

2026-01-22 04:40:14

定义和核心概念1. 零知识证明(ZK-Proofs)是一种加密协议,使一方能够向另一方证明陈述的真实性,而不会泄露超出该陈述有效性的任何潜在信息。 2. ZK-proof 必须满足三个基本属性:完整性、健全性和零知识——这意味着诚实的证明者可以说服诚实的验证者,不诚实的证明者不能误导验证者,除非概率...

什么是区块链三难困境? (安全性、可扩展性和去中心化)

什么是区块链三难困境? (安全性、可扩展性和去中心化)

2026-01-15 17:00:25

了解核心冲突1. 区块链三难困境描述了一个基本的架构约束,即在单个区块链协议中同时最大化安全性、可扩展性和去中心化是极其困难的。 2. 每个重大设计决策都需要权衡——增加吞吐量通常需要减少节点数量或简化共识逻辑,这会削弱去中心化或引入新的攻击向量。 3. Bitcoin优先考虑安全性和去中心化,但将...

查看所有文章

User not found or password invalid

Your input is correct